New Patriotic Party (NPP) presidential aspirant and Member of Parliament for Abetifi, Dr Bryan Acheampong, has expressed strong confidence in winning the party’s 2026 presidential primary.

He dismissed claims that he lacks popularity at the grassroots, insisting that he has a firm grip on the party’s delegate base.

Speaking on Asempa FM’s Ekosii Sen show, Dr Acheampong said propaganda narratives and psychological operations in politics will not affect his chances, as delegates have already made up their minds about their preferred candidate.

“I have profiled about 190,000 delegates. I know those who will vote for me and those who will not. None of the other candidates can beat me in this election,” he stated.

Dr Acheampong added that opinion polls would not change the minds of delegates, stressing that their choices are already settled.

He further revealed that his campaign is supported by a 40,000-member nationwide team, noting that he remains unperturbed by negative claims and fully confident of victory in the upcoming primary.
